AN impressive century opening partnership by the Dewhurst brothers laid the foundations for IntrasoftTech Walkovers’ victory in the JEP Brighter KO Cup final last night.
Bradley Vautier’s team were twice runners-up in previous JEP finals, twice runners-up in S E Guy Memorial Trophy finals while moving up to Division I and twice beaten finalists in the NatWest Indoor League.
Vautier said: ‘At last, a cup final victory and, obviously, I’m delighted.
‘We had a fantastic start; Andy and Sam started the ball rolling really well. Sam was on top first and then Andy caught up quickly and they got their half centuries around the same time.
‘It was a magnificent opening stand and it helped us put on a very competitive total of 175 for three and I was very happy about that.’
